NEW ERA FOR MALAWI FOOTBALL BEGINS

(By Vinjeru Ngwira)

Malawi takes a significant step forward in football development today, Saturday, 24 May 2025, as Mchinji hosts the official launch of a national second-tier league. This initiative is the result of a partnership between the Football Association of Malawi (FAM) and NBS Bank.

The newly established NBS Bank National Division League aims to close the gap between the elite Super League and the regional leagues. It offers a vital platform for emerging players to develop and showcase their talent on a broader stage.

FAM’s Director of Competitions and Communications, Gomezgani Zakazaka, welcomed the development, calling it the realization of a long-standing vision within the sport.

“This initiative is intended to give more players national exposure—especially those who might otherwise go unnoticed,” said Zakazaka. “Historically, most national team players have come from the Super League. With this league, we hope to broaden the talent pool and provide greater opportunities.”

To mark the beginning of this new era, Mchinji Community Ground will host the opening match between Mchinji Villa FC and Mitundu Baptist, a symbolic start to a more inclusive and competitive football system in the country.
